Insulation Options for Garage Doors
Insulating garage doors is a critical action in improving energy effectiveness and keeping a comfortable interior environment. Correct insulation minimizes heat loss in wintertime and reduces heat gain in summer, inevitably reducing power prices and improving the general capability of the garage space.
There are a number of insulation choices readily available for garage doors. One prominent option is polystyrene foam, which offers a high R-value, showing superb thermal resistance. This material is light-weight and can be quickly installed within the door panels. An additional option is polyurethane foam, which supplies even much better insulation due to its greater thickness and structural strength. This form of insulation is commonly discovered in pre-insulated garage doors.

Eventually, picking the appropriate insulation alternative depends on details needs, neighborhood climate, and spending plan considerations. A well-insulated garage door not just boosts power effectiveness yet likewise adds to a more comfy living area.

Sealant and Weatherstripping Solutions
Effective sealant and weatherstripping solutions play an essential duty in enhancing the power performance of garage doors. These parts are crucial in preventing air leakages, which can cause considerable energy loss and enhanced heating or air conditioning expenses. Appropriate sealing reduces drafts and assists keep a stable temperature within the garage, eventually adding to the general performance of the home.

It is necessary to examine the condition of existing sealants and weatherstripping routinely. Indications of wear, such as cracks or spaces, show that replacement is needed to ensure ideal efficiency. When installing new weatherstripping, ensure a snug fit, as this will certainly improve its performance in blocking unwanted air exchange.

Regular Maintenance Practices
Normal maintenance techniques are important for maintaining the energy performance of garage doors, especially after applying sealant and weatherstripping solutions. Routine inspections can assist identify possible issues prior to they intensify into even more significant troubles. It index is a good idea to examine the door's seals, tracks, and hardware to ensure they are in ideal condition.
Lubrication of relocating parts, such as hinges and rollers, is vital to decrease rubbing and improve functional efficiency. A well-lubricated door runs efficiently, minimizing energy consumption. In addition, checking and tightening loosened hardware, like screws and bolts, can avoid imbalance, which may jeopardize energy effectiveness.
Cleaning up the door and its parts is additionally important, as dirt and debris can hinder performance. Moreover, inspecting the garage door opener's setups and performance guarantees it operates effectively, contributing to the general energy-saving efforts.
